数据管理的实践案例:学习成功的经验

1.背景介绍

数据管理是现代企业和组织中不可或缺的一部分,它涉及到数据的收集、存储、处理、分析和应用等方面。随着数据的规模和复杂性不断增加,数据管理的重要性也不断提高。本文将从实际案例的角度,探讨数据管理的核心概念、算法原理、操作步骤和数学模型,并提供具体的代码实例和解释。

1.1 数据管理的重要性

数据管理对于企业和组织来说是至关重要的,因为它可以帮助企业更好地理解其客户、市场和竞争对手,从而提高业务效率和竞争力。同时,数据管理还可以帮助企业更好地管理风险,预测市场趋势,并优化其业务流程。

1.2 数据管理的挑战

尽管数据管理对企业和组织来说非常重要,但也面临着一些挑战。这些挑战包括数据的大规模、高速增长、不断变化、不可靠性和不完整性等。因此,企业和组织需要采取一系列措施来解决这些挑战,以确保数据的质量和可靠性。

1.3 数据管理的解决方案

为了解决数据管理的挑战,企业和组织需要采取一系列措施,包括数据的收集、存储、处理、分析和应用等。这些措施可以帮助企业更好地管理数据,提高数据的质量和可靠性。

2.核心概念与联系

2.1 数据管理的核心概念

数据管理的核心概念包括数据的收集、存储、处理、分析和应用等。这些概念是数据管理的基础,企业和组织需要理解和掌握这些概念,以确保数据的质量和可靠性。

2.1.1 数据的收集

数据的收集是数据管理的第一步,它涉及到从不同的数据源中收集数据,如数据库、文件、网络等。数据的收集需要考虑数据的质量、可靠性和完整性等因素。

2.1.2 数据的存储

数据的存储是数据管理的第二步,它涉及到将收集到的数据存储到不同的存储设备中,如硬盘、云存储等。数据的存储需要考虑数据的安全性、可靠性和可用性等因素。

2.1.3 数据的处理

数据的处理是数据管理的第三步,它涉及到对收集到的数据进行清洗、转换、分析等操作,以提高数据的质量和可靠性。数据的处理需要考虑数据的准确性、完整性和一致性等因素。

2.1.4 数据的分析

数据的分析是数据管理的第四步,它涉及到对处理后的数据进行统计、图表、模型等方法的分析,以得出有关企业和组织的有价值的信息和见解。数据的分析需要考虑数据的可靠性、可用性和可解释性等因素。

2.1.5 数据的应用

数据的应用是数据管理的第五步,它涉及到将分析结果应用到企业和组织的业务流程中,以提高业务效率和竞争力。数据的应用需要考虑数据的实用性、可行性和可持续性等因素。

2.2 数据管理的核心联系

数据管理的核心联系是数据的收集、存储、处理、分析和应用之间的联系和关系。这些联系和关系是数据管理的基础,企业和组织需要理解和掌握这些联系和关系,以确保数据的质量和可靠性。

2.2.1 数据的一致性

数据的一致性是数据管理的一个重要联系,它涉及到数据的收集、存储、处理、分析和应用之间的一致性。数据的一致性需要考虑数据的准确性、完整性和一致性等因素。

2.2.2 数据的可靠性

数据的可靠性是数据管理的一个重要联系,它涉及到数据的收集、存储、处理、分析和应用之间的可靠性。数据的可靠性需要考虑数据的安全性、可用性和可靠性等因素。

2.2.3 数据的可用性

数据的可用性是数据管理的一个重要联系,它涉及到数据的收集、存储、处理、分析和应用之间的可用性。数据的可用性需要考虑数据的可用性、可读性和可解释性等因素。

3.核心算法原理和具体操作步骤以及数学模型公式详细讲解

3.1 数据的收集

3.1.1 数据的收集原理

数据的收集原理是数据管理的第一步,它涉及到从不同的数据源中收集数据,如数据库、文件、网络等。数据的收集需要考虑数据的质量、可靠性和完整性等因素。

3.1.2 数据的收集步骤

数据的收集步骤包括以下几个步骤:

  1. 确定数据需求:首先需要确定企业和组织的数据需求,以便于选择合适的数据源。

  2. 选择数据源:根据数据需求,选择合适的数据源,如数据库、文件、网络等。

  3. 收集数据:从选定的数据源中收集数据,并确保数据的质量、可靠性和完整性等因素。

  4. 存储数据:将收集到的数据存储到不同的存储设备中,如硬盘、云存储等。

3.1.3 数据的收集数学模型公式

数据的收集数学模型公式为:

$$ D = \sum_{i=1}^{n} d_i $$

其中,$D$ 表示数据的收集,$d_i$ 表示第 $i$ 个数据源的数据,$n$ 表示数据源的数量。

3.2 数据的存储

3.2.1 数据的存储原理

数据的存储原理是数据管理的第二步,它涉及到将收集到的数据存储到不同的存储设备中,如硬盘、云存储等。数据的存储需要考虑数据的安全性、可靠性和可用性等因素。

3.2.2 数据的存储步骤

数据的存储步骤包括以下几个步骤:

  1. 选择存储设备:根据数据需求,选择合适的存储设备,如硬盘、云存储等。

  2. 存储数据:将收集到的数据存储到选定的存储设备中,并确保数据的安全性、可靠性和可用性等因素。

  3. 备份数据:为了保证数据的安全性和可靠性,需要对数据进行备份,以防止数据丢失和损坏。

  4. 维护数据:需要定期对数据进行维护,以确保数据的安全性、可靠性和可用性等因素。

3.2.3 数据的存储数学模型公式

数据的存储数学模型公式为:

$$ S = \sum_{i=1}^{m} s_i $$

其中,$S$ 表示数据的存储,$s_i$ 表示第 $i$ 个存储设备的数据,$m$ 表示存储设备的数量。

3.3 数据的处理

3.3.1 数据的处理原理

数据的处理原理是数据管理的第三步,它涉及到对收集到的数据进行清洗、转换、分析等操作,以提高数据的质量和可靠性。数据的处理需要考虑数据的准确性、完整性和一致性等因素。

3.3.2 数据的处理步骤

数据的处理步骤包括以下几个步骤:

  1. 数据清洗:对收集到的数据进行清洗,以确保数据的准确性、完整性和一致性等因素。

  2. 数据转换:将收集到的数据进行转换,以适应企业和组织的需求。

  3. 数据分析:对处理后的数据进行分析,以得出有关企业和组织的有价值的信息和见解。

  4. 数据存储:将处理后的数据存储到不同的存储设备中,以确保数据的安全性、可靠性和可用性等因素。

3.3.3 数据的处理数学模型公式

数据的处理数学模型公式为:

$$ P = \sum_{i=1}^{n} p_i $$

其中,$P$ 表示数据的处理,$p_i$ 表示第 $i$ 个处理操作的数据,$n$ 表示处理操作的数量。

3.4 数据的分析

3.4.1 数据的分析原理

数据的分析原理是数据管理的第四步,它涉及到对处理后的数据进行统计、图表、模型等方法的分析,以得出有关企业和组织的有价值的信息和见解。数据的分析需要考虑数据的可靠性、可用性和可解释性等因素。

3.4.2 数据的分析步骤

数据的分析步骤包括以下几个步骤:

  1. 选择分析方法:根据数据需求,选择合适的分析方法,如统计、图表、模型等。

  2. 数据分析:对处理后的数据进行分析,以得出有关企业和组织的有价值的信息和见解。

  3. 结果解释:解释分析结果,以便企业和组织可以利用这些信息和见解来提高业务效率和竞争力。

  4. 结果应用:将分析结果应用到企业和组织的业务流程中,以提高业务效率和竞争力。

3.4.3 数据的分析数学模型公式

数据的分析数学模型公式为:

$$ A = \sum_{i=1}^{m} a_i $$

其中,$A$ 表示数据的分析,$a_i$ 表示第 $i$ 个分析方法的数据,$m$ 表示分析方法的数量。

3.5 数据的应用

3.5.1 数据的应用原理

数据的应用原理是数据管理的第五步,它涉及到将分析结果应用到企业和组织的业务流程中,以提高业务效率和竞争力。数据的应用需要考虑数据的实用性、可行性和可持续性等因素。

3.5.2 数据的应用步骤

数据的应用步骤包括以下几个步骤:

  1. 选择应用方法:根据分析结果,选择合适的应用方法,如决策支持、预测分析、优化模型等。

  2. 应用结果:将分析结果应用到企业和组织的业务流程中,以提高业务效率和竞争力。

  3. 效果评估:对应用结果进行评估,以确保应用结果的实用性、可行性和可持续性等因素。

  4. 结果反馈:根据应用结果的评估结果,对应用方法进行调整,以提高应用结果的实用性、可行性和可持续性等因素。

3.5.3 数据的应用数学模型公式

数据的应用数学模型公式为:

$$ U = \sum_{i=1}^{n} u_i $$

其中,$U$ 表示数据的应用,$u_i$ 表示第 $i$ 个应用方法的数据,$n$ 表示应用方法的数量。

4.具体代码实例和详细解释说明

4.1 数据的收集

4.1.1 数据的收集代码实例

import requests
from bs4 import BeautifulSoup

url = 'https://www.example.com'
response = requests.get(url)
soup = BeautifulSoup(response.text, 'html.parser')
data = []

for item in soup.find_all('div', class_='item'):
    title = item.find('h2').text
    price = item.find('span', class_='price').text
    data.append({
        'title': title,
        'price': price
    })

print(data)

4.1.2 数据的收集详细解释说明

在这个代码实例中,我们使用了 Python 的 requests 和 BeautifulSoup 库来收集数据。首先,我们使用 requests 库发送 GET 请求到指定的 URL,然后使用 BeautifulSoup 库解析响应的 HTML 内容。接着,我们遍历 HTML 中的所有 'div' 元素,并提取其中的标题和价格信息。最后,我们将提取到的信息存储到一个列表中,并打印出来。

4.2 数据的存储

4.2.1 数据的存储代码实例

import json

data = [
    {'title': 'Product A', 'price': 10.99},
    {'title': 'Product B', 'price': 19.99},
    {'title': 'Product C', 'price': 29.99}
]

with open('data.json', 'w') as f:
    json.dump(data, f)

4.2.2 数据的存储详细解释说明

在这个代码实例中,我们使用了 Python 的 json 库来存储数据。首先,我们定义了一个包含数据的列表。接着,我们使用 with 语句打开一个文件,并使用 json.dump() 函数将数据写入文件。最后,我们关闭文件。

4.3 数据的处理

4.3.1 数据的处理代码实例

import json

with open('data.json', 'r') as f:
    data = json.load(f)

data_processed = []
for item in data:
    item['price'] = float(item['price'].replace('.', ''))
    data_processed.append(item)

print(data_processed)

4.3.2 数据的处理详细解释说明

在这个代码实例中,我们使用了 Python 的 json 库来处理数据。首先,我们使用 with 语句打开一个文件,并使用 json.load() 函数将数据加载到内存中。接着,我们遍历数据列表,并对价格信息进行清洗,将小数点后的数字转换为浮点数。最后,我们将清洗后的数据存储到一个新的列表中,并打印出来。

4.4 数据的分析

4.4.1 数据的分析代码实例

import pandas as pd

data_processed = [
    {'title': 'Product A', 'price': 10.99},
    {'title': 'Product B', 'price': 19.99},
    {'title': 'Product C', 'price': 29.99}
]

df = pd.DataFrame(data_processed)
print(df.describe())

4.4.2 数据的分析详细解释说明

在这个代码实例中,我们使用了 Python 的 pandas 库来分析数据。首先,我们定义了一个包含数据的列表。接着,我们使用 pandas.DataFrame() 函数将数据转换为 DataFrame 对象。最后,我们使用 df.describe() 函数对数据进行描述性统计分析,并打印出来。

4.5 数据的应用

4.5.1 数据的应用代码实例

import pandas as pd

data_processed = [
    {'title': 'Product A', 'price': 10.99},
    {'title': 'Product B', 'price': 19.99},
    {'title': 'Product C', 'price': 29.99}
]

df = pd.DataFrame(data_processed)

def recommend(df):
    recommendations = []
    for index, row in df.iterrows():
        if row['price'] < 20:
            recommendations.append(row['title'])
    return recommendations

print(recommend(df))

4.5.2 数据的应用详细解释说明

在这个代码实例中,我们使用了 Python 的 pandas 库来应用数据。首先,我们定义了一个包含数据的列表。接着,我们使用 pandas.DataFrame() 函数将数据转换为 DataFrame 对象。最后,我们定义了一个 recommend() 函数,该函数遍历 DataFrame 中的所有行,并根据价格信息筛选出满足条件的产品。最后,我们打印出满足条件的产品列表。

5.未来发展与挑战

未来发展与挑战主要包括以下几个方面:

  1. 数据管理技术的不断发展和进步,如大数据处理、机器学习、人工智能等技术的不断发展和进步,将对数据管理产生重要影响。

  2. 数据管理的规范和标准的不断完善,如数据管理的规范和标准的不断完善,将对数据管理产生重要影响。

  3. 数据管理的应用场景的不断拓展,如企业和组织的不断拓展,将对数据管理产生重要影响。

  4. 数据管理的挑战,如数据的可靠性、可用性、可遵守性等方面的挑战,将对数据管理产生重要影响。

6.附录:常见问题与解答

6.1 常见问题1:数据管理的核心原理是什么?

答:数据管理的核心原理是将数据收集、存储、处理、分析、应用等步骤进行统一管理,以确保数据的质量、可靠性、可用性等方面。

6.2 常见问题2:数据管理的核心概念是什么?

答:数据管理的核心概念包括数据的收集、存储、处理、分析、应用等步骤,以及它们之间的关系和联系。

6.3 常见问题3:数据管理的核心算法原理是什么?

答:数据管理的核心算法原理包括数据的收集、存储、处理、分析、应用等步骤的算法和模型,以及它们之间的关系和联系。

6.4 常见问题4:数据管理的核心步骤是什么?

答:数据管理的核心步骤包括数据的收集、存储、处理、分析、应用等步骤,以及它们之间的关系和联系。

6.5 常见问题5:数据管理的核心技术是什么?

答:数据管理的核心技术包括数据的收集、存储、处理、分析、应用等步骤的技术和方法,以及它们之间的关系和联系。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值